What Exactly Are Teflon Lined Tanks?

Simply put, a teflon lined tank is a containment vessel coated on its inside surface with polytetrafluoroethylene (PTFE), widely known by its brand name, Teflon. This lining forms a slick, non-stick, and chemically inert barrier between the tank's metal body and the products inside.

Why does this matter? Well, Teflon resists almost all chemicals — acids, bases, solvents — so it prevents corrosion, contamination, or unwanted chemical reactions. This makes such tanks indispensable in modern processing industries, pharmaceutical manufacturing, or even humanitarian efforts where clean water and safe storage matter endlessly. Key Features That Make Teflon Lined Tanks Stand Out

Durability and Chemical Resistance

One of the core draws of Teflon lined tanks is their unmatched resistance to harsh chemicals. Because the lining is impervious, the metal underneath stays protected, extending the tank’s lifespan by years if not decades. Industries dealing with aggressive acids or alkaline mixtures rely on this technology to avoid costly leaks or catastrophic corrosion failures.

Scalability and Size Versatility

Oddly enough, Teflon lining technology isn’t just for tiny vessels. Manufacturers can coat tanks from a few hundred liters to tens of thousands, enabling diverse industrial uses. This scalability means plants can customize storage solutions without sacrificing quality or chemical protection.

Cost Efficiency Over Time

Granted, the upfront cost for Teflon lining can feel steep compared to standard tanks. But since these tanks reduce maintenance, cleaning downtime, and the risk of contamination or failure, many businesses find this investment pays off in operational savings.

Compliance with Industry Standards

From food and beverage to pharmaceuticals, many regulations mandate use of inert surfaces to avoid contamination. Teflon lined tanks help companies meet or exceed ISO, FDA, and other standards, easing audit processes and boosting product safety.

Ease of Cleaning and Maintenance

Thanks to Teflon's slick surface, residues rarely stick. This reduces cleaning time and chemical usage — a huge plus for plants juggling fast product changeovers or batch production.

Overcoming Common Challenges with Experts’ Insight

One bottleneck remains: the cost and complexity of applying high-quality Teflon linings, which require specialized equipment and skilled labor. For smaller or emerging markets, this sometimes limits availability.

But recent solutions include modular tank designs that ship lined components for onsite assembly, and robotic lining application systems improving quality and cutting costs. Many suppliers also offer extended warranties and consultative support.

So while challenges persist, creative industry responses keep the benefits within reach of more businesses worldwide.

FAQs About Teflon Lined Tanks

What makes Teflon lined tanks better than plain stainless steel tanks?
Teflon lining offers superior chemical resistance and non-stick properties, which prevent corrosion and contamination that stainless steel alone might not withstand. This ensures longer durability and safer storage for harsh chemicals.
Can Teflon lined tanks handle food-grade products safely?
Absolutely. Teflon is FDA-approved for food contact and prevents flavor contamination, making these tanks ideal for dairy, juices, and other sensitive products.
How long does the Teflon lining typically last?
With proper maintenance, Teflon linings can last 10-20 years or more, depending on tank use and chemical exposure. Regular inspections help maximize lifespan.
Are these tanks customizable to specific industrial needs?
Yes, tanks can be sized and lined to precise requirements, including thickness of lining, tank shape, and integration with mixers or heaters.

Product Specification Table: Typical Teflon Lined Tank

Specification Details
Material Carbon Steel or Stainless Steel (Body)
Lining Polytetrafluoroethylene (PTFE), 0.25 – 0.5 mm thick
Capacity Range 500 Liters to 50,000 Liters
Temperature Range -50°C to +260°C
Pressure Range Up to 3 bar (can be customized)
Certifications FDA, ISO 9001, CE
